@@itsjennystyle thank you so much for replying!❤️ And what would you suggest for people with dehydrated and dry skin? I been struggling to find something and I love your videos :)
victoria hope i have dehydrated and dry skin as well! So whats worked for me (product wise) are products containing hyaluronic acid (all year around) and ceramides (especially in winter). There are so many great products out there containing these ingredients but i like the hadalabo line, rovectin HA toner, toridden dive in HA serum. For ceramides, my recent faves are tonymoly ceramide mochi toner and holika holika good cera cream. Oh and i also love the atobarrier 365 cream mist so much (the one in the vid, has a high amount of ceramides).
Also its important to seal in moisture so using facial oil/cream mist really helps esp in winter! I love squalane oil products. The ordinary one is so affordable and amazing.

Hello, I have a question for you. I have pigment spots on my face, which of your Korean creams would you recommend to me?. Please help me out. Thank you.
hi hi 🙋🏻♀️Vitamin C or niacinamide serums are known to fade dark spots/hyperpigmentation! I'd recommend using one of them to see if that helps. Klairs Freshly Juiced Vitamin C Drop (shown in the vid) is a good product to start with because it's gentle and the product is really great. Klair has vit C serums with higher %s too.
There's lots of niacinamide serums out there as well (I heard lots of good things), but I haven't personally used any yet, so can't really recommend a specific one right now. I'd love to incorporate one into my skincare routine soon too, so if I do, I will mention it in my next skincare vid. :)

@@itsjennystyle thanks for the reply!! i have dry skin too but notice i get breakouts at least twice a month and im still unsure if its diet related or the products i use TT
fel no problem! If you want to find out whats causing your breakouts, you can experiment. If you feel like a particular product is causing your breakouts then try eliminating the product from your skin care to see if theres any difference.
With your diet, you can try “elimination diet” to see if a type of food is causing your breakouts. Elimination diet is certainly not easy but well worth it not just for your skin but for your overall health. Ive tried it and its been really useful! Its used to discover food sensitivities/intolerances (which could also lead to allergies and skin problems).
